# Thinking about using nix/rix instead of docker (or maybe add as an option)
# Installation ------------------------------------------------------------
# Users need to install rix and Nix
# Install rix
install.packages("rix", repos = c("https://b-rodrigues.r-universe.dev", "https://cloud.r-project.org"))
# Install Nix
# From terminal: curl --proto '=https' --tlsv1.2 -sSf -L https://install.determinate.systems/nix | sh -s -- install
# So /nix environment and files are not in the root folder
# Edit /etc/fstab and add:
# /home/path_to/nix /nix none bind 0 0
# Create Nix file ---------------------------------------------------------
library("rix")
path_default_nix <- "~/Downloads/TEST_NIX"
rix(r_ver = "latest",
r_pkgs = c("cli", "dplyr", "DT", "forcats", "ggplot2", "gtsummary", "here", "janitor", "patchwork", "psych", "purrr", "readr", "renv", "rmarkdown", "rstudioapi", "stringr", "tarchetypes", "targets", "testthat", "tibble", "tidyr", "visNetwork"),
system_pkgs = "pandoc",
git_pkgs = NULL,
# ide = "rstudio",
ide = "other",
shell_hook = "Rscript -e 'targets::tar_make()'", # Will launch the pipeline
project_path = path_default_nix,
overwrite = TRUE,
print = TRUE)
# COPY PROJECT TO THE NIX FOLDER
FILES = list.files(".", recursive = TRUE)
R.utils::copyDirectory(".", path_default_nix)
# Build (on terminal)
nix-build
# Launch shell (on terminal)
nix-shell
# If you want to open rstudio in the nix-shell and it fails:
export QT_XCB_GL_INTEGRATION=none
rstudio
